Appalachian Development Highway System Completion Act of 2009

Appalachian Development Highway System Completion Act of 2009 - Authorizes appropriations out of the Highway Trust Fund (other than the Mass Transit Account) for FY2010-FY2015 for the Appalachian development highway system program. Directs the Secretary of Transportation to apportion such funds among the appropriate states to complete construction of the Appalachian development highway system. Authorizes states of the system to loan apportioned amounts between themselves.
